  • “Let Not Your Heart Be Troubled”

    Feeling weighed down by fear, uncertainty, or grief? Join us for the sermon “Let Not Your Hearts Be Troubled” from John 14:1–14 with Rev. Rob Jones. Discover the comfort of a Savior who not only prepares a place for His people, but draws near to troubled hearts right now. Come hear how Jesus—our way, our truth, and our life—meets us in the storm with a promised home, a present peace, and a hope that cannot be shaken.

  • Are We Listening?

    Are we truly listening—to Jesus, or to the whispers of division and fear? In this sermon on Luke 6:27–38, Rev. Rob Jones challenges us to love our enemies, reject cynicism, and practice a radical generosity that reflects the heart of Christ. Discover how turning the other cheek, giving without expecting in return, and resisting the devil’s lies can transform our lives, our communities, and our witness to the world. Come be encouraged, convicted, and called deeper into the boundless love and mercy of God. Are you listening?

  • …and His Disciples Believed In Him

    Join Rev. Rob Jones as he explores Jesus’ first miracle at the wedding in Cana and what it reveals about God’s sovereign grace, covenant promises, and transforming power. Discover how water turned to wine points to a new covenant in Christ’s blood, a foretaste of the great messianic banquet, and the gift of saving faith. Come be reminded that in Christ, our empty jars are filled, our joy is renewed, and “his disciples believed in him.”
